#724123 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#724123 is composed of 44.7% red, 25.5%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 43% magenta, 69.3%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 22.8 degrees, a saturation of 53% and a lightness of 29.2%. #724123 color hex could be obtained by blending #e48246 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#724123 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#724123 has RGB values of R:114, G:65, B:35 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.43, Y:0.69,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 7487779.

Shades and Tints of #724123
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090503 is the darkest color, while #fdfbf9 is the lightest one.
